Output 809725c10996d36a7283b9e10d9f9bc1187a49f8eaffbb5c0ee66c62c9585cf4:4

value
37720958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 526b20c690a2878827602e30767b1ced65a841c5 OP_EQUAL
address
MFQwyYdy6h82EGeXL3LA3mgq3WQUWNzRUt
transaction
809725c10996d36a7283b9e10d9f9bc1187a49f8eaffbb5c0ee66c62c9585cf4
spent
true